A new day and new Switch Hacking News:

The original 'Hekate-ipl' for Switch doesn't do complete eMMC dumping, and there been few other forks that improved on this, but @CTCaer version is improving rapidly, and as such needs its own news thread to report on it and his updates, so check it out below:
Hekate - ipl / CTCaer mod v1.2 - Automatic RAW eMMC partial dumping

Changelog v1.2:

  • Write errors to SD card are now fatal (as per FatFs/Diskio guidelines). You can still choose what to do though:
    • Abort and try again right away from the last part (recommended)
    • Continue (and potentially have a corrupt dump)

  • Fix SD card not mounting (by fixing the switch to low voltage 1.8v for these cards. Normally happening in Samsung sd cards)
  • Add high speed support for high voltage SD Cards

Description:

The main difference with the official hekate - ipl is support for automatic partial dumping for your Switch's eMMC. Additionally, there are some other quality of life small changes.

  • It automatically starts partial dumping (even in exFAT formatted SD Cards), based on the available free space. Supports both FAT32 and exFAT.
  • If you have enough space and an exFAT formatted partition, it will automatically choose to dump the raw eMMC as one big file.

Detailed release notes:

  • This release lets you dump the USER partition, or the whole RAW eMMC.
  • The automatic partial dump is only activated if you don't have enough space in your SD card to dump the whole eMMC.
  • The partial dumping is done in 15 2GB parts.
  • This way you can even use a 4GB sd card to dump the whole eMMC.

Normal dumping Procedure: If you have enough space, it will automatically dump your eMMC as one big file.
Partial dumping Procedure:

  1. Run hekate-ipl_ctcaer_1.2payload
  2. Select "Dump RAW eMMC"
  3. When this is finished, press any key and Power off Switch from main menu
  4. Move the files from SD card to your PC to free some space
    Don't move the partial.idx file!
  5. Unplug and re-plug USB while pressing Vol+
  6. Run hekate-ipl_partial_dumping again and press Dump RAW eMMC to continue
  7. Join the files with your favorite cmd or app

Notice 1: Users that only have a 2GB or 4GB SD card, use the hekate-ipl_ctcaer_1.2_GBparts payload.
Notice 2: If you have an unfinished partial dumping and want to start anew, delete the partial.idx file first.

Warning: When dumping the eMMC, in parts, you should not power on the switch normally and boot to Switch OS before done. Otherwise your finished backup will probably corrupt, because Switch OS writes on your eMMC even if it seems you done nothing.

There are also windows and linux scripts provided, that join these 15 2GB files into one. In windows, you can then use @rajkosto biskeydump and HacDiskMount to manipulate your raw eMMC dump.

Thanks:
naehrwert for the original code: https://github.com/nwert/hekate
@rajkosto for his hekate - ipl commits and tools: https://github.com/rajkosto/hekate

OFFICIAL SITE: --> https://github.com/CTCaer/hekate/releases/tag/v1.2

NEWS SOURCE: [RCM Payload] Hekate mod - raw full nand backup (via) GBATemp

via
http://www.maxconsole.com/threads/sw...ate-ipl.46936/